Although the delivery of support activities is also managed by teams within DE&S, the planning process for these functions is somewhat different to that used for procurement.
Responsibility for the support of in-service equipment is split between Front Line Commands (who plan for the first four years) and the Head of Capability (who is responsible for the following six years).
For new equipment, all planning relating to support remains with the Head of Capability until it has been in-service for four years. After that, the equipment is considered to be in-service and its support is managed as such. Therefore over time all equipment support planning will transition to the Head of Capability.
